Transaction 3475515a28d65f7db51352ebbfd56d3c64194acb834d79266f768f3e217f1686
1 Input
2 Outputs
- 3475515a28d65f7db51352ebbfd56d3c64194acb834d79266f768f3e217f1686:0
- 3475515a28d65f7db51352ebbfd56d3c64194acb834d79266f768f3e217f1686:1
value 711581
address 37Ts6S2UDbnWx7QyVjtVAmPfVzehNH5ZZv
value 1353973
address 1EFNQXvXqmaD4F1d3hneLUf6saKWQMwrjp